AI Technical Summary

Technical Problem

During the cleaning process of the tool changer in an existing five-axis machining center, debris easily adheres to the annular sponge cleaning plate, affecting the use of the tools.

Method used

A tool changer for a five-axis machining center was designed. The cleaning roller slides in conjunction with the tool. The shaft is driven to rotate the cleaning roller through a transmission component. The cleaning roller cleans the surface of the tool during its movement and collects debris using upper and lower collection boxes.

Benefits of technology

It effectively reduces the possibility of debris adhering to the tool during tool changing, ensures tool cleanliness, and improves machining efficiency and tool life.

TECHNICAL FIELD

[0001] The utility model belongs to tool changing device technical field, and relates to a tool changing device of five -axis machining center. BACKGROUND

[0002] Five -axis machining center is a kind of machining equipment that can be linked on five degrees of freedom, mainly used for processing complex surface and complex parts. It realizes the processing of space arbitrary angle by the linkage of tool or workpiece on five degrees of freedom, and is especially suitable for processing aerospace parts, complex mould and special-shaped surface etc. Because different tools need to be used in different workpieces and different processing stages in the processing process, tool changing device needs to be used.

[0003] The automatic tool changing structure of vertical machining center disclosed in Chinese patent CN217619298U is provided with a cleaning mechanism on the tool, and the cleaning mechanism includes two straight rods, two rotating rollers, two annular sponge cleaning plates, four link plates and four force springs. The annular sponge cleaning plate is tightly attached to the tool by the force spring, and then the debris adhered to the tool is cleaned.

[0004] The tool changing device makes the annular sponge cleaning plate clean the tool, and after cleaning, the debris will stick to the annular sponge cleaning plate. When the tool is extended, it will contact the annular sponge cleaning plate again, so that the debris is easy to fall on the tool, affecting the use of the tool.

[0005] To solve the above problems, the utility model provides a tool changing device of five -axis machining center. UTILITY MODEL CONTENTS

[0052] Working principle:

[0053] Fix the tool changer 1 on the five-axis machining center. In the initial state, the torsion spring drives the connecting plate 7 to rotate to the inclined state, so that the two cleaning rollers 6 are not in contact with the tool 2. And the upper cleaning roller 6 is not in contact with the upper collecting box 4, and the lower cleaning roller 6 is not in contact with the lower collecting box 16. One end of the elastic rope 8 is wound on the wire roller 9, and one end of the elastic rope 8 pulls the movable block 17, so that the movable block 17 is located at the end away from the middle part of the tool changer 1 in the second sliding groove 18. The limiting block 24 is located at the side close to the middle part of the tool changer 1 of the movable block 17.

[0054] Start the motor, and the output shaft of the motor drives the cam 11 to rotate. The protruding end of the cam 11 rotates to the side of the tool 2 to be replaced, and the protruding end of the cam 11 pushes the tool 2 to move in the installation slot 3 to the outside of the tool changer 1.

[0055] The tool 2 will drive the slider 21 to slide in the first sliding groove 19, and the slider 21 will slide on the first guide rod 20 and compress the first spring 22.

[0056] The slider 21 will drive the connecting block 14 to move, and the limiting block 24 will move to the movable block 17 and press the movable block 17. Since the movable block 17 is located at the end of the second sliding groove 18, the movable block 17 cannot move, so the movable block 17 will press the limiting block 24. The limiting block 24 will move to the side close to the connecting block 14 and compress the second spring 13.

[0057] When the limiting block 24 moves to the side of the movable block 17 away from the middle of the tool changer 1, the second spring 13 will push the limiting block 24 away from the connecting block 14.

[0058] Until the end of the tool 2 is moved out of the installation slot 3, the tool 2 is used.

[0059] When the tool needs to be changed, the end of the cam 11 is turned away from the abutting tool 2. At this time, the tool 2 is no longer pressed, and the first spring 22 will push the slider 21 to slide towards the middle of the tool changer 1, and the slider 21 will drive the tool 2 to move towards the inside of the tool changer 1.

[0060] The slider 21 will drive the connecting block 14 and the limiting block 24 to move, and the limiting block 24 will push the movable block 17, so that the movable block 17 will slide on the second guide rod 23. And the movable block 17 will move in the second sliding groove 18 towards the middle of the tool changer 1.

[0061] The movable block 17 will pull one end of the elastic rope 8, the elastic rope 8 will be stretched, and the other end of the elastic rope 8 will turn away from the wire roller 9. The wire roller 9 will be driven to rotate, and the shaft rod 12, the connecting plate 7, the connecting rod 10, and the cleaning roller 6 will rotate towards the outer surface of the tool 2. At the same time, the torsional spring on the shaft rod 12 will be twisted.

[0062] Until the upper cleaning roller 6 rotates to the upper surface of the tool 2, and the upper cleaning roller 6 is located at the opening of the upper collecting box 4. The lower cleaning roller 6 rotates to the lower surface of the tool 2, and the lower cleaning roller 6 is located at the opening of the lower collecting box 16.

[0063] When the cleaning roller 6 contacts the tool 2, there is no elastic rope 8 wound on the wire roller 9. The movement of the movable block 17 will stretch the elastic rope 8, and the torsional spring will be twisted to the maximum state, so that the shaft rod 12 and the connecting plate 7 will no longer rotate.

[0064] Moving the tool 2 between the two cleaning rollers 6 will drive the two cleaning rollers 6 to rotate. The cleaning roller 6 will remove the debris stuck on the tool 2, and as the cleaning roller 6 rotates, the debris on the cleaning roller 6 will fall into the corresponding upper collecting box 4 or lower collecting box 16 through the opening.

[0065] After the limiting block 24 pushes the movable block 17 to move to the second sliding groove 18, the movable block 17 is close to one end of the middle part of the tool magazine 1. The movable block 17 will extrude the limiting block 24, so that the limiting block 24 slides at the end of the movable block 17 and compresses the second spring 13. When the limiting block 24 leaves the end of the movable block 17, the movable block 17 no longer extrudes the limiting block 24, at this time the second spring 13 will push the limiting block 24 away from the connecting block 14. The tool 2 is completely moved into the tool magazine 1.

[0066] Since the limiting block 24 no longer limits the movable block 17, the elastic rope 8 is no longer stretched. The elastic rope 8 will return to its original state, thereby pulling the movable block 17 to slide in the second sliding groove 18. And under the action of the torsion spring, the shaft rod 12 rotates, the connecting plate 7 rotates, the cleaning roller 6 leaves the tool 2. At the same time, the shaft rod 12 drives the wire roller 9 to rotate, and the elastic rope 8 is rotated onto the wire roller 9 again.

[0067] By rotating the first fastening screw 5, the upper collecting box 4 can be disassembled and cleaned. By rotating the second fastening screw 15, the lower collecting box 16 can be disassembled and cleaned.
